Is Tammy Faye Bakker Still Living?

Direct Answer: Is Tammy Faye Bakker Still Living?

No, Tammy Faye Bakker is not still living. She died on July 20, 2007, at age 65, after a yearslong battle with cancer. Her death was widely reported by reputable outlets and marked the end of a public life defined by televised ministry, celebrity evangelism, and later, a reflective public legacy. Health Decline and Final Years

In 1996, Tammy Faye was diagnosed with cancer. Over the following decade, she underwent treatments, surgeries, and periods of remission. The cancer progressed, and she became increasingly focused on comfort, privacy, and spiritual matters. In her final years, she used a wheelchair and spoke candidly about mortality and faith. She made limited public appearances, including interviews that reflected on her legacy and regrets. Her death in 2007 was attributed to cancer complications.
